Bio-Ethanol Fireplaces

A bio-ethanol fireplace offers numerous advantages. It does not emit harmful smoke or gases and does not require a chimney, or flue.

Free standing bio ethanol fireplaces provide stunning focal points for any living space. They can be moved from room-to-room when needed.

Wall-mounted bio-ethanol fireplaces are an ideal option for those with limited space since they can be placed in a wall niche or be recessed into it. They are easy to install and offer a modern aesthetic.

Eco-friendly

A bioethanol fireplace is an environmentally friendly way to enjoy the warmth of a fireplace in your home. Bioethanol fuel is made from renewable resources such as corn, sugar cane, and potatoes. They don't emit any fumes or smoke, making them a better alternative to traditional wood and gas fireplaces. They are simple to set up and operate. The flame could take up 20 to 30 minutes to fully ignite.

Ethanol fireplaces are a great alternative for homeowners with limited access to natural gas or a chimney breast. They can be installed anywhere in the house unlike gas or solid fire places made of fuel. They can be used as a focal point for an area or as a stylish accent piece. They can be used outdoors however they must be kept away from flammable substances and animals.

If you adhere to basic safety rules, you will not experience any issues when using bio-ethanol fire. It shouldn't be put in a flammable area and should be at least one two metres away from any other objects. Do not move a biofire that is already lit, or attempt to refill the fuel while it's still burning. This could result in severe burns.

Ethanol fireplaces are simple to clean and maintain. It is not necessary to add water or stoke ethanol fires, because they do not emit harmful emissions. You can also top them off when they run out, saving you money and prolonging the life of your fireplace.

Secure

Ethanol fireplaces are a reliable option for heating your home because they don't emit harmful pollutants. However, it's necessary to take the necessary precautions to shield yourself and your family from the dangers posed by this kind of fire. You should only use bioethanol that has been declared safe by the manufacturer for this reason. You should also store the fuel in a secure place, away from children and pets.
